Performing music from his second album Americana (released April 2025), Eddie Gripper tells the story of an 8,000 km hitchhiking journey from Alaska to California, completed in under two months during the summer of 2022. The music captures the vast landscapes and unforgettable moments along the way – from sleeping in the Alaskan wilderness to cycling down Santa Monica Pier – offering a vivid, hopeful, yet unflinching reflection on American life.

Artist Bio:
Having “already garnered comparisons with the greats” (Jazzwise) after the release of his debut album ‘Home’, pianist Eddie Gripper has rapidly established himself as a young contender on the national jazz circuit.
He has worked as a performer, promoter and producer alongside top musicians in his field such as Nigel Price, Simon Spillett and Alex Clarke. As a composer, he has collaborated with vocalist Elijah Jeffery, releasing a self-titled album in 2025 songs that explore the intersections of jazz, singer-songwriter, classical and folk traditions.
In 2024, Gripper embarked on a 29-date tour across the four nations of the UK and Republic of Ireland, and remains active on the national and international scene (having played at venues such as Crazy Coqs, Pizza Express and various festivals, both under his own name and with other projects).
